About Guaiac Wood Oil

Guaiac Wood Oil is sourced from Bulnesia sarmientoi. It is offered standardized for Guaiol, CAS 8016-32-8. Traditional and industrial applications include fine perfumery, aromatherapy, cosmetics, and household fragrance.

What are wood and bark oils?

These are essential oils obtained by steam distillation of wood and bark raw material, used in fragrance, aromatherapy, and pharmaceutical applications.
